Pedro Castillo failed to fulfill his campaign promise and received his 17 salaries plus bonuses

From absolute misrule to a democratic transition

No more poor in a rich country“, He said during the presidential campaign, in 2021. One of the promises that made him popular with voters was that he would give up the presidential salary. “I will lead the country with a teacher’s salary. The golden form is over, we are going to give up the life pension ”, he said from . However, during his months in the Presidency of Peru, he collected every penny.

A report from Panorama revealed the ballots of the former president, today imprisoned for attempting to carry out a coup on December 7. The professor charged, even for those days before he himself marked his fate with the Message to the Nation in which he announced the unconstitutional closure of the .

LOOK: Protests in Peru: Prosecutor’s Office orders the release of 192 detainees in San Marcos

In December 2022, Castillo charged S/17,114 for six business days plus the truncated bonus. According to the records found in the presidential office, he collected all the ballots for the 17 months that he was in power.

That is, he did not keep his promise for a single month. In December 2021, he received a bonus of S / 300, for political election remuneration S / 16,000 and for an extraordinary special concept S / 15,000 more. The same concepts were collected in July 2022.

In total, collecting all the bonuses, salaries, bonuses and others, in his year and five months of management he accumulated close to S/250 thousand soles, that is, a quarter of a million only in his presidential salaries.
